Fix #34205: Zooming in rendered mode during update out of sync with intended zoom
Yes, again. There's some t within which reset is not allowed. This is so no reset happens too often for performance issues. If camera changes too often, some reset could be missed because of this timeout. For now tag engine for update, which will update viewport from blender side. Proper solution could be to detect such a changes from blender side and tag cycles for refresh instead of trying to detect changes form cycles, but that's for later.
